20-Time World of Outlaws Champion Steve Kinser to Lead The Charge Into Williams Grove Speedway



Steve Kinser was there for the first World of Outlaws race at Williams Grove Speedway in 1978, and he has been there every step of the way as the always intense rivalry between the Outlaws and the Pennsylvania Posse has developed over the years. He has won his fair share of the battles at the track, having claimed 37 overall triumphs at the storied half-mile including preliminary feature wins.

On Thursday, May 17 and Friday, May 18, the 20-time World of Outlaws champion will lead the charge into Williams Grove Speedway as the World of Outlaws make their first of three stops at the hallowed track this season. With 27 drivers following the World of Outlaws full-time in addition to the always tough contenders from the Pennsylvania Posse, the level of competition will be at an all-time high this week. Adding even more luster to the event, is the fact that the cameras from SPEED will be rolling on Saturday, to tape the event for broadcast on Sunday, June 3.
